pinkprincess39 wrote: »Re the funeral visits for ESA.....do I have to leave the premises after my scenario and go straight back in or can I just reveal as soon as they have answered my queries?
ta!
You have to leave and then go back in. I go somewhere quiet and complete as much of the questionairre as I can remember from my initial visit and then I know exactly what to ask about when I go back in usually 10/15 mins later.0 -
